Summary
A few angiokeratoma are normal, but numerous lesions may indicate Fabry disease. Genetic screening and family history are crucial for diagnosis when lesions are widespread.

Background:
- Angiokeratoma are benign vascular lesions that can appear on the skin.
- Their presence can sometimes be associated with underlying systemic conditions.
Observation:
- Many individuals present with a small number of scattered angiokeratoma.
- A higher density or numerous angiokeratoma lesions warrant further medical investigation.
Findings:
- The occurrence of numerous angiokeratoma should raise suspicion for Fabry disease, a rare genetic disorder.
- Checking the family history is an essential step in evaluating potential cases.
Implications:
- Early consideration of Fabry disease based on skin findings can lead to timely diagnosis and management.
- This highlights the importance of dermatological examination in identifying potential genetic conditions.

Some receptors remain unoccupied even when an agonist produces a maximal response. Such empty ones are called spare receptors. In presence of spare receptors the maximum effect of an agonist drug is achieved with fewer than 100% of the receptors being occupied. To determine the presence of spare receptors, scientists often compare the concentration of the drug needed to produce 50% of the maximum effect (EC50) with the concentration of the drug needed to occupy 50% of the receptors (Kd).
